The day was almost over and Soo Yun was going crazy. Not once had Jaejoong contacted her. Usually, if he was busy he would send her a note early in the morning, but today, nothing had arrived, not even his presence.

                She felt so alone, the past days he has been keeping her company and to have him just disappear like this again was upsetting and she almost felt like crying. He may have left her 6 months ago before, but she had a warning then. Now, he didn’t even say anything and he probably won’t ever.

                Her mood was down all day, she could barely focus. She had dropped three cups of coffee throughout the day by bumping into people and things, one cup even broke into pieces. She found it hard to concentrate when she didn’t know what was wrong. Had she done something? Was he finally tired of trying to catch her?

                Soo Yun had even told herself at one point that it might just be nothing, but it didn’t feel right. It didn’t feel like just nothing, and she was getting really worried over it. She even attempted to call his phone but the first ring never reached him.

                Night had settled across the sky and Soo Yun’s energy felt drained. She slumped all the way home, having a little hope that he’ll be there waiting for her and clear all her frustrations away. But he wasn’t there. There were no candlelight coming from the dining table and there were no smell of any type of food.

                Soo Yun dropped her bag by the door and sighed in disappointment. She the lights and went on with her usual routine. She changed into more comfortable clothes and made herself dinner. When she laid in bed that night, she kept her eyes on the single rose placed by the window. It was his rose, and she wondered what he thought of when he had picked out that specific one for her. She had taken special care of it and it had survived long enough to still look just as beautiful before. Yet, right in front of her eyes, one petal detached itself from the center and fell slowly down. She shut her eyes closed from the view, hoping her love wouldn’t end the same.
